Should You Install Your Own Dishwasher?
From transporting a dishwasher into your residence to connecting the water connections, setting up a dishwasher can occupy to 5 hrs. It might take also longer if you do not have the right tools. To make your life much easier and to prevent mounting a dishwashing machine improperly, we recommend working with a specialist plumber. A plumber will certainly have the right tools on hand and can install your new dishwasher in under 2 hrs. A Plumber Can Check the Supply Lines


A supply line, specifically a dishwashing machine port, links the dish washer to a water resource. If you purchase a brand-new supply line, a plumber can make certain that the line is compatible with both your dishwashing machine as well as water resource. If you decide to make use of an existing supply line, a specialist plumber can check it to guarantee that it remains in good condition and also does not have any kind of leaks.

An Improper Installment Can Invalidate the Dishwashing machine's Service warranty


Before setting up a dishwasher on your own, you should read the guarantee meticulously. Also a little harming the dishwashing machine during the setup process can nullify the guarantee. Since the cost of a dishwasher ranges in between $300 to $1,000 as well as upwards, that can be a costly blunder. Even if the dishwashing machine still functions, you will not have the ability to change it must it break soon. So, unless you are handy and have experience setting up dishwashing machines, you should work with a plumber so you do not risk your service warranty.

Mounting a Dish Washer Calls For a Variety of Equipments


If you do not have a selection of tools on hand, you might need to make a trip to Lowe's or Home Depot. To mount a dish washer, you need the adhering to devices: pliers, a flexible wrench, a set of screwdrivers, a tube cutter, as well as hole saws.

Not Installing Your Dishwashing Machine Correctly Can Result In a Hill of Troubles


Not only can installing a dish washer correctly nullify your service warranty, but it can also create a mess. As an example, if you do not install the supply line appropriately, you could deal with leaks-- or even worse, a flooding. You might also exper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s too promptly with your pipelines and also creates loud trembling noises. Last but not least, if you inaccurately install your dish washer to the waste disposal unit, you might discover pungent smells or have residue on your dishes.

A Plumber Can End Up the Task Affordably and also Rapidly


A plumber can mount your dishwashing machine in one to 2 hrs. The ordinary plumber will not bill even more than a pair of hundred dollars to mount your dishwasher.

PLUMBING SERVICES YOU'LL NEED FOR A KITCHEN REMODEL


S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ION


If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.


If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per. When shopping for a new sink, consider upgrading to features like extensions, sprayers, soap dispensers and a stainless steel garbage disposal.
